EPA v. Hunt Petroleum (AEC), Inc.
Final Order With Penalty
Case summary
Permittee operates oil & gas facilities in the Outer Continental Shelf of the Gulf of Mexico. Permittee is subject to regulations of the Clean Water Act (CWA) and National Pollutant Discharge Elimination System (NPDES). Permittee failed to comply with the NPDES Offshore General Permit.
